There is no “official” central repository for these files. Unlike DLL files (which you can get from Microsoft), shader caches are often user-generated and game-specific. Downloading a random .bin file from an untrusted source is a prime way to get malware, ransomware, or a keylogger .
The safest way to resolve this error is to force the game to regenerate the file naturally. Since the shader cache is essentially a compiled list of instructions, the game engine is designed to rebuild it if it goes missing.
